38 # Script to produce VFS front-end sugar.
39 #
40 # usage: vnode_if.sh srcfile
41 # (where srcfile is currently /sys/kern/vnode_if.src)
42 #
43
44 if [ $# -ne 1 ] ; then
45 echo 'usage: vnode_if.sh srcfile'
46 exit 1
47 fi
48
49 # Name and revision of the source file.
50 src=$1
51 SRC_ID=`head -1 $src | sed -e 's/.*\$\(.*\)\$.*/\1/'`
52
53 # Names of the created files.
54 out_c=vnode_if.c
55 out_h=../sys/vnode_if.h
56
57 # Awk program (must support nawk extensions)
58 # Use "awk" at Berkeley, "nawk" or "gawk" elsewhere.
59 awk=${AWK:-awk}
60
61 # Does this awk have a "toupper" function? (i.e. is it GNU awk)
62 isgawk=`$awk 'BEGIN { print toupper("true"); exit; }' 2>/dev/null`
63
64 # If this awk does not define "toupper" then define our own.
65 if [ "$isgawk" = TRUE ] ; then
66 # GNU awk provides it.
67 toupper=
68 else
69 # Provide our own toupper()
70 toupper='
71 function toupper(str) {
72 _toupper_cmd = "echo "str" |tr a-z A-Z"
73 _toupper_cmd | getline _toupper_str;
74 close(_toupper_cmd);
75 return _toupper_str;
76 }'
77 fi
78
79 #
80 # This is the common part of all awk programs that read $src
81 # This parses the input for one function into the arrays:
82 # argdir, argtype, argname, willrele
83 # and calls "doit()" to generate output for the function.
84 #
85 # Input to this parser is pre-processed slightly by sed
86 # so this awk parser doesn't have to work so hard. The
87 # changes done by the sed pre-processing step are:
88 # insert a space beween * and pointer name
89 # replace semicolons with spaces
90 #
91 sed_prep='s:\*\([^\*/]\):\* \1:g
92 s/;/ /'
93 awk_parser='
94 # Comment line
95 /^#/ { next; }
96 # First line of description
97 /^vop_/ {
98 name=$1;
99 argc=0;
100 next;
101 }
102 # Last line of description
103 /^}/ {
104 doit();
105 next;
106 }
107 # Middle lines of description
108 {
109 argdir[argc] = $1; i=2;
110 if ($2 == "WILLRELE") {
111 willrele[argc] = 1;
112 i++;
113 } else
114 willrele[argc] = 0;
115 argtype[argc] = $i; i++;
116 while (i < NF) {
117 argtype[argc] = argtype[argc]" "$i;
118 i++;
119 }
120 argname[argc] = $i;
121 argc++;
122 next;
123 }
124 '
